Origin
He was the fourth son of Victor Amaday II (* 1666, † 1732), Duke of Savoy and King of Sardinia (such as Victor Amaday I), and of his first wife, French Princess Anna-Maria Orleans (* 1669, † 1728). His grandparents on the father's side are the Savoy Duke Karl Emmanuel II and Maria Jeanne Batista Savoyska-Nemour, and by mother He is the uncle of French King Louis XV.

Biography

Early years and relations with his father
Since he was not the firstborn son of Victor Amaday II, Karl Immanuel was not destined to be Crown Prince. But his older brother, Victor Amaday, died in 1715
